A new amplifier has been created by KJF audio and Stefan Whatcott specifically for those who require 2 to 8 audio channels at affordable prices. “A Flexible project aimed at audio and cinema-philes, who require 2 to 8 channels of best in class D amp technology at sensible prices.” Watch the demonstration video below to learn more about the muliti-channel Hypex N-core amplifier which is launched via Kickstarter this week.
“KJF audio are small UK company who produce flat-pack speaker kits using full range speaker drivers, we are mostly known for our brilliant Frugel-Horn kits using the Markaudio full range drivers. Our products have been critically acclaimed in reviews by the UK audio press. Our customers are keen audio enthusiasts and music lovers. Our reason for being is to keep high end audio honest. There is so much ‘foo’ sold into the audio market at ridiculous prices. We make and sell stuff that works well at a wallet friendly price with no bull.“
“The MA-01 is a fully customisable multi-channel amplifier. Designed for a world of changing needs, this amplifier can be reconfigured back at base so that as your audio setup changes so too can your amplifier. Need a 500/250/125 Watt stereo amplifier for your DIY active speaker build, no problem. Need 6 x 250 Watt channels for your home cinema set up, no problem. A standard stereo set-up, no problem. Return to base to reconfigure your stereo amp for active speakers, no problem. This amplifier was designed in a modular way to allow us to build a custom amplifier for each customer’s needs without every amplifier being a fully custom ground up build. The MA-01 uses the Hypex N-core modules that in the Hi-End hi-fi industry have become synonymous with very high performance. ”
For more details and full specification jump over to the official Kickstarter crowdfunding campaign page where the amplifier is now available to back with early bird pledges available from £850. If all goes well worldwide shipping is expected to take place during March 2019.
